2021-10-20lib: change thread_add_* APIIgor Ryzhov
Do not return pointer to the newly created thread from various thread_add functions. This should prevent developers from storing a thread pointer into some variable without letting the lib know that the pointer is stored. When the lib doesn't know that the pointer is stored, it doesn't prevent rescheduling and it can lead to hard to find bugs. If someone wants to store the pointer, they should pass a double pointer as the last argument. Signed-off-by: Igor Ryzhov <iryzhov@nfware.com>
2021-08-23*: explicitly print "exit" at the end of every node configIgor Ryzhov
There is a possibility that the same line can be matched as a command in some node and its parent node. In this case, when reading the config, this line is always executed as a command of the child node. For example, with the following config: ``` router ospf network 193.168.0.0/16 area 0 ! mpls ldp discovery hello interval 111 ! ``` Line `mpls ldp` is processed as command `mpls ldp-sync` inside the `router ospf` node. This leads to a complete loss of `mpls ldp` node configuration. To eliminate this issue and all possible similar issues, let's print an explicit "exit" at the end of every node config. This commit also changes indentation for a couple of existing exit commands so that all existing commands are on the same level as their corresponding node-entering commands. Fixes #9206. 2021-06-02northbound: KISS always batch yang config (file read), it's fasterChristian Hopps
The backoff code assumed that yang operations always completed quickly. It checked for > 100 YANG modeled commands happening in under 1 second to enable batching. If 100 yang modeled commands always take longer than 1 second batching is never enabled. This is the exact opposite of what we want to happen since batching speeds the operations up. Here are the results for libyang2 code without and with batching. | action | 1K rts | 2K rts | 1K rts | 2K rts | 20k rts | | | nobatch | nobatch | batch | batch | batch | | Add IPv4 | .881 | 1.28 | .703 | 1.04 | 8.16 | | Add Same IPv4 | 28.7 | 113 | .590 | .860 | 6.09 | | Rem 1/2 IPv4 | .376 | .442 | .379 | .435 | 1.44 | | Add Same IPv4 | 28.7 | 113 | .576 | .841 | 6.02 | | Rem All IPv4 | 17.4 | 71.8 | .559 | .813 | 5.57 | (IPv6 numbers are basically the same as iPv4, a couple percent slower) Clearly we need this. Please note the growth (1K to 2K) w/o batching is non-linear and 100 times slower than batched. Notes on code: The use of the new `nb_cli_apply_changes_clear_pending` is to commit any pending changes (including the current one). This is done when the code would not correctly handle a single diff that included the current changes with possible following changes. For example, a "no" command followed by a new value to replace it would be merged into a change, and the code would not deal well with that. A good example of this is BGP neighbor peer-group changing. The other use is after entering a router level (e.g., "router bgp") where the follow-on command handlers expect that router object to now exists. The code eventually needs to be cleaned up to not fail in these cases, but that is for future NB cleanup. Signed-off-by: Christian Hopps <chopps@labn.net>

2021-03-17*: require semicolon after DEFINE_MTYPE & coDavid Lamparter
Back when I put this together in 2015, ISO C11 was still reasonably new and we couldn't require it just yet. Without ISO C11, there is no "good" way (only bad hacks) to require a semicolon after a macro that ends with a function definition. And if you added one anyway, you'd get "spurious semicolon" warnings on some compilers... With C11, `_Static_assert()` at the end of a macro will make it so that the semicolon is properly required, consumed, and not warned about. Consistently requiring semicolons after "file-level" macros matches Linux kernel coding style and helps some editors against mis-syntax'ing these macros. 2020-08-03lib: introduce configuration back-off timer for YANG-modeled commandsRenato Westphal
When using the default CLI mode, the northbound layer needs to create a separate transaction to process each YANG-modeled command since they are supposed to be applied immediately (there's no candidate configuration nor the "commit" command like in the transactional CLI). The problem is that configuration transactions have an overhead associated to them, in big part because of the use of some heavy libyang functions like `lyd_validate()` and `lyd_diff()`. As of now this overhead is substantial and doesn't scale well when large numbers of transactions need to be performed in sequence. As an example, loading 50k prefix-lists using a single transaction takes about 2 seconds on a modern CPU. Loading the same 50k prefix-lists using 50k transactions can take more than an hour to complete (which is unacceptable by any standard). To fix this problem, some heavy optimization work needs to be done on libyang and on the FRR northbound itself too (e.g. perform partial configuration diffs whenever possible). This, however, should be a long term effort since these optimizations shouldn't be trivial to implement and we're far from having the performance numbers we need. In the meanwhile, this commit introduces a simple but efficient workaround to alleviate the issue. In short, a new back-off timer was introduced in the CLI to monitor and detect when too many YANG-modeled commands are being received at the same time. When a certain threshold is reached (100 YANG-modeled commands within one second), the northbound starts to group all subsequent commands into a single large transaction, which allows them to be processed much faster (e.g. seconds and not hours). It's essentially a protection mechanism that creates dynamically-sized transactions when necessary to prevent performance issues from happening. This mechanism is enabled both when parsing configuration files and when reading commands from a terminal. The downside of this optimization is that, if several YANG-modeled commands are grouped into the same transaction and at least one of them fails, the whole transaction is rejected. This is undesirable since users don't expect transactional behavior when that's not enabled explicitly. To minimize this issue, the CLI will log all commands that were rejected whenever that happens, to make the user aware of what happened and have enough information to fix the problem. Commands that fail due to parsing errors or CLI-level validations in general are rejected separately. Again, this proposed workaround is intended to be temporary. The goal is to provided a quick fix to issues like #6658 while we work on better long-term solutions. Signed-off-by: Renato Westphal <renato@opensourcerouting.org>

2020-05-28lib: introduce the northbound context structureRenato Westphal
The new northbound context structure contains information about the client performing a configuration transaction. This information will be made available to all configuration callbacks through the args->context parameter. The usefulness of this structure comes from the fact that it can be used as a communication channel (both input and output) between the northbound callbacks and the northbound clients. This can be done through its "client_data" field which contains client-specific data. This should cover some very specific scenarios where a northbound callback should perform an action only if the configuration change is coming from a given client. An example would be sending a PCEP response to a PCE when an SR-TE policy is created or modified through the PCEP northbound client (for that to happen, the northbound callbacks need to have access to the PCEP request ID, which needs to be available).
